Creare un upload

Questa discussione si intitola Creare un upload nella sezione Off-Topic. Avendo perso molti file, e vedendo che la maggior parte dei filesharing stanno chiudendo, vorrei correre un pò ai ripari. Mezzo mio forum, aveva i ...

Creare un upload

Messaggioda Haku » 24/01/2012, 20:23

Avendo perso molti file, e vedendo che la maggior parte dei filesharing stanno chiudendo, vorrei correre un pò ai ripari.
Mezzo mio forum, aveva i file caricati in diversi di quei siti, perdendo così più della metà di demo e progetti :/

Mi chiedevo, c'è la possibilità di creare una pagine interna/esterna che dia la possibilità di far caricare i loro progeti agli utenti?
Vorrei evitare gli allegati :/
Avatar utente
Haku
Traduttore
Traduttore
 
Messaggi: 2527
Iscritto il: 22/09/2009, 22:36
Sesso: Maschio
Versione: 3.0.9
MOD:
Server: UNIX/Linux
phpBB SEO:

  • Condividi questa discussione
  • Ti piace questa discussione?
    Condividila! :)

Re: Creare un upload

Messaggioda Carlo » 24/01/2012, 22:10

Scusa, ma l'uso degli allegati non ti piace?
MODs | Stili | Traduzioni MOD
Ogni MP contenente una richiesta di supporto verrà ignorato.

Dropbox: 2 GB di spazio di archiviazione GRATIS! Registrati ora!
BidVertiser: Guadagna con il tuo sito! Registrati ora!
Avatar utente
Carlo
Amministratore
Amministratore
 
Messaggi: 8897
Iscritto il: 19/04/2009, 10:24
Località: Puglia
Sesso: Maschio
Versione: 3.0.9
MOD:
Server: UNIX/Linux
phpBB SEO:
PHP: 5.3.8
Database: MySQL 5.1.60-community-log


Re: Creare un upload

Messaggioda Barrnet » 24/01/2012, 22:22

MM basterebbe un qualunque form per l'invio dei dati a una cartella via ftp, il problema è poi ricreare l'url, ma sopratutto lo spazio...
Prima di installare una mod pensa...
Immagine
Regolamento ~ Guida al ripristino integrale FTP ~ Guida al backup
Avatar utente
Barrnet
Leader Moderatori
Leader Moderatori
 
Messaggi: 2117
Iscritto il: 04/07/2010, 23:31
Sesso: Maschio
Versione: 3.0.10
MOD:
Server: UNIX/Linux
phpBB SEO:
PHP: 5.3.10
Database: MySQL 5.1.61-community-log


Re: Creare un upload

Messaggioda Carlo » 24/01/2012, 23:36

Leggi l'ultimo articolo pubblicato nel blog, sopratutto la parte finale, relativa agli allegati.
MODs | Stili | Traduzioni MOD
Ogni MP contenente una richiesta di supporto verrà ignorato.

Dropbox: 2 GB di spazio di archiviazione GRATIS! Registrati ora!
BidVertiser: Guadagna con il tuo sito! Registrati ora!
Avatar utente
Carlo
Amministratore
Amministratore
 
Messaggi: 8897
Iscritto il: 19/04/2009, 10:24
Località: Puglia
Sesso: Maschio
Versione: 3.0.9
MOD:
Server: UNIX/Linux
phpBB SEO:
PHP: 5.3.8
Database: MySQL 5.1.60-community-log


Re: Creare un upload

Messaggioda Haku » 25/01/2012, 1:29

Ho letto, ma, sinceramente, non hoc apito se il creatore dello stesso stile, abbia creato anche qualche codice.
Scusa, ma l'uso degli allegati non ti piace?

Vorrei proprio evitare di 'lavorare' su phpbb, e magari appensantirne il database.

MM basterebbe un qualunque form per l'invio dei dati a una cartella via ftp, il problema è poi ricreare l'url, ma sopratutto lo spazio...

Non lo so fare e non so che script valido cercare in rete...soprattuto appunto che ricrei l'url.
Lo spazio, acquisterei spazio illimitato...in fondo, non upperanno file da 2 gb l'uno, massimo di 100 mb.
Avatar utente
Haku
Traduttore
Traduttore
 
Messaggi: 2527
Iscritto il: 22/09/2009, 22:36
Sesso: Maschio
Versione: 3.0.9
MOD:
Server: UNIX/Linux
phpBB SEO:

Re: Creare un upload

Messaggioda Carlo » 25/01/2012, 13:50

Il database? Per qualche dato (circa 500 allegati) occuperà si e no 1-2 MB. asd

Siamo nel 2012, oggi, non dovrebbero più esserci problemi di capienza. rotfl
MODs | Stili | Traduzioni MOD
Ogni MP contenente una richiesta di supporto verrà ignorato.

Dropbox: 2 GB di spazio di archiviazione GRATIS! Registrati ora!
BidVertiser: Guadagna con il tuo sito! Registrati ora!
Avatar utente
Carlo
Amministratore
Amministratore
 
Messaggi: 8897
Iscritto il: 19/04/2009, 10:24
Località: Puglia
Sesso: Maschio
Versione: 3.0.9
MOD:
Server: UNIX/Linux
phpBB SEO:
PHP: 5.3.8
Database: MySQL 5.1.60-community-log


Re: Creare un upload

Messaggioda Micogian » 25/01/2012, 22:20

Il database è l'ultimo dei problemi per gli allegati. Nel database non ci vanno gli allegati ma i relativi dati.
Il problema, secondo me, non è nemmeno l'upload, ci sono molti script che permettono di esportare file in remoto e viceversa.
Il problema è un altro: la funzione upload di PHPBB ha l'handicap di inserire tutti gli allegati in una unica cartella (files), alcuni host, specialmente quelli gratuiti o quasi non consentono a volte di aprire cartelle voluminose.
Il vantaggio però della funzione "allegati" è che i file vengono rinominati. Cosa succederebbe in una funzione personalizzata di "upload" se viene inserito un file diverso ma con lo stesso nome ? verrebbe sovrascritto.
Che due file abbiano lo stesso nome non è impossibile.
Poi, se vogliamo gestire un archivio personalizzato di "allegati" dobbiamo comunque gestire un database pe ri dati e dobbiamo anche gestire, oltre all'upload anche il download e la visualizzazione (che si può fare con il tag [IMG]).
Insomma, si può anche fare (io per alcuni settori dei miei forum lo faccio) ma non è cosa semplice se vogliamo farla seriamente.
Avatar utente
Micogian
Leader Programmatori
Leader Programmatori
 
Messaggi: 2490
Iscritto il: 07/01/2010, 9:51
Località: Udine
Versione: 3.0.10
MOD:
Server: UNIX/Linux
phpBB SEO: No
PHP: 5.2.9
Database: MySQL 5.0.77

Re: Creare un upload

Messaggioda Haku » 26/01/2012, 4:39

Micogian ha scritto:Il database è l'ultimo dei problemi per gli allegati. Nel database non ci vanno gli allegati ma i relativi dati.
Il problema, secondo me, non è nemmeno l'upload, ci sono molti script che permettono di esportare file in remoto e viceversa.
Il problema è un altro: la funzione upload di PHPBB ha l'handicap di inserire tutti gli allegati in una unica cartella (files), alcuni host, specialmente quelli gratuiti o quasi non consentono a volte di aprire cartelle voluminose.
Il vantaggio però della funzione "allegati" è che i file vengono rinominati. Cosa succederebbe in una funzione personalizzata di "upload" se viene inserito un file diverso ma con lo stesso nome ? verrebbe sovrascritto.
Che due file abbiano lo stesso nome non è impossibile.
Poi, se vogliamo gestire un archivio personalizzato di "allegati" dobbiamo comunque gestire un database pe ri dati e dobbiamo anche gestire, oltre all'upload anche il download e la visualizzazione (che si può fare con il tag [IMG]).
Insomma, si può anche fare (io per alcuni settori dei miei forum lo faccio) ma non è cosa semplice se vogliamo farla seriamente.

Sapresti darmi due dritte Mico?
Avatar utente
Haku
Traduttore
Traduttore
 
Messaggi: 2527
Iscritto il: 22/09/2009, 22:36
Sesso: Maschio
Versione: 3.0.9
MOD:
Server: UNIX/Linux
phpBB SEO:

Re: Creare un upload

Messaggioda Micogian » 26/01/2012, 9:00

Haku ha scritto:Sapresti darmi due dritte Mico?

Haku, qui non si tratta di dare due dritte, come ho già detto la cosa è complessa, va studiata nei particolari e tempo da dedicarci non ne avrei proprio.
Dipende anche da cosa dovresti caricare, se sono immagini la soluzione degli "allegati" mi sembra la più logica.
Se devi caricare file più corposi il problema è creare tutta la struttura per gestire upload, informzioni, download, ecc. non è cosa da poco.
Avatar utente
Micogian
Leader Programmatori
Leader Programmatori
 
Messaggi: 2490
Iscritto il: 07/01/2010, 9:51
Località: Udine
Versione: 3.0.10
MOD:
Server: UNIX/Linux
phpBB SEO: No
PHP: 5.2.9
Database: MySQL 5.0.77

Re: Creare un upload

Messaggioda Carlo » 26/01/2012, 14:58

Micogian ha scritto:Il vantaggio però della funzione "allegati" è che i file vengono rinominati. Cosa succederebbe in una funzione personalizzata di "upload" se viene inserito un file diverso ma con lo stesso nome ? verrebbe sovrascritto

Se sai come inviare un file via un modulo HTML, e sai "prenderlo" e "copiarlo" sul file system via il PHP, è facile cambiare il nome con un md5 o altro sistema.
MODs | Stili | Traduzioni MOD
Ogni MP contenente una richiesta di supporto verrà ignorato.

Dropbox: 2 GB di spazio di archiviazione GRATIS! Registrati ora!
BidVertiser: Guadagna con il tuo sito! Registrati ora!
Avatar utente
Carlo
Amministratore
Amministratore
 
Messaggi: 8897
Iscritto il: 19/04/2009, 10:24
Località: Puglia
Sesso: Maschio
Versione: 3.0.9
MOD:
Server: UNIX/Linux
phpBB SEO:
PHP: 5.3.8
Database: MySQL 5.1.60-community-log


Prossimo

Torna a Off-Topic

SEO Search Tags

creare in forum phpbb area nascosta      creare un uploading      fare un upload      file sharing stanno chiudendo      phpbb upload      upload video phpbb3      creare un file sharing      creare un upload      creare upload       

Chi c’è in linea

Visitano il forum: Nessuno e 1 ospite

  • Pubblicità